在数据库管理中,索引是提高查询性能的重要工具。通过创建索引,数据库可以更快地定位和检索数据,从而减少查询时间。本文将详细介绍如何在SQL中创建索引,并探讨其实际应用场景。
什么是索引?
索引类似于书籍的目录,它允许数据库系统快速找到表中的特定数据,而不必扫描整个表。索引通常建立在表的一列或多列上,这些列经常用于查询条件或排序操作。
为什么需要索引?
当表中的数据量很大时,查询操作可能会变得非常缓慢。索引通过创建一个额外的数据结构(通常是B树或哈希表),使得数据库可以快速定位到所需的数据行,从而显著提高查询性能。
如何创建索引?